The Boston Planning and Development Agency will be hosting a virtual community meeting on Wednesday, November 30 6:00 PM – 8:00 PM to discuss 17 Farnsworth Street Project. Zoom Link: bit.ly/3X7tT36 Toll-Free: (833) 568 – 8864 Meeting ID: 161 790 6366
Proponent: Bentall Green Oak Project
Description:
The BPDA is hosting a virtual Impact Advisory Group Meeting meeting for the proposed project at 17 Farnsworth Street, a project located in the Fort Point neighborhood of Boston. The purpose of the meeting is to provide an overview of the project, and discuss the potential impacts and mitigation for the project. The meeting will include a presentation followed by questions and comments from the public.
